Day 1: Arrival and Introduction to York

Arrive independently at the Elmbank Hotel, York from 15.00.
This evening there will be a welcome reception, private dinner with wine and a talk by Professor Anne Anderson: ‘Leeds and York: Art and Industry‘.

Day 2: Whitby and Scarborough

This morning we visit St Mary’s Church in Whitby for a free-flow exploration of this historic site, accompanied by our guide, Anne Anderson. We then continue to the Whitby Museum and Pannett Art Gallery, where the group will enjoy a special talk from the curator on the Jet and Jet Jewellery Collection. Afterwards, there is free time to explore the museum and view the collection, with access also to the Pannett Art Gallery. Following this, we enjoy free time for lunch (not included), before rejoining the coach for Scarborough.

In the afternoon, we visit St Martin-on-the-Hill Church, where a church guide will lead a tour of this remarkable building, known for its Pre-Raphaelite connections. Here we’ll see William Morris-designed stained glass windows and wall paintings by leading Pre-Raphaelite artists. Second talk from Anne this evening: ‘Pre-Raphaelites in Yorkshire‘.

Day 3: Leeds City Art Gallery and Lotherton Hall

We start our touring today at Leeds Art Gallery with its interesting collection of modern art as well as being home to the Henry Moore Institute, a world-recognised centre for the study of sculpture. Anne will then guide a walking tour taking in the Art nouveau architecture around the Victorian Quarter, including magnificent shopping arcades, such as the County Arcade, Leeds Town Hall and the Corn Exchange.

After free time for lunch (not included), we head by coach to Lotherton Hall, a fine Victorian country home and chapel which was home to the Gascoigne family from 1825 until it was gifted to the city of Leeds in 1968. It is a charming house, and a visit here gives a taste of the lives of both the English upper classes and their servants. Return to the hotel for approx. 17.00.

Elmbank Hotel, York
Located in historic York, the Elmbank Hotel boasts one of the UK’s finest and most complete Art Nouveau collections, including stained-glass, beautiful murals, and detailed stencils.
